目录

一、前言

二、开发环境准备

2.1 下载并安装DevEco Studio

2.2 配置OpenHarmony SDK

三、安装步骤

四、创建新工程

4.1 工程创建

4.2 程序完善

4.2.1 程序代码

五、总结


一、前言

        OpenHarmony,作为华为公司自主开发的开源操作系统,旨在为各类智能设备提供统一、高效、安全的软件生态。随着其不断发展和完善,越来越多的开发者开始关注并投入到OpenHarmony应用开发中。本文将详细介绍如何在标准OpenHarmony上设置并运行一个应用,从开发环境准备到应用部署的全过程,帮助初学者快速上手OpenHarmony应用开发。

二、开发环境准备

2.1 下载并安装DevEco Studio

        DevEco Studio是华为推出的针对OpenHarmony应用开发的集成开发环境(IDE),集成了代码编辑、编译、调试等功能,极大地方便了开发者的开发流程。访问DevEco Studio官网下载并安装最新版本。

2.2 配置OpenHarmony SDK

        下载SDK:通过DevEco Studio或直接从OpenHarmony官方网站下载SDK。

        配置SDK路径:在DevEco Studio中,通过“Settings”->“System Settings”->“SDK Manager”配置OpenHarmony SDK的路径。

        环境变量设置:将SDK路径添加到系统的环境变量中,以便在命令行中直接使用相关命令。

三、安装步骤

        首先下载DevEco Studio(HarmonyOS应用的集成开发境),点击:IDE下载页面,点击立即下载。

        下载完成后,双击运行安装程序,进入安装向导。

        随后一直点击 "Next" 直到安装完成。

 

        至此安装完成。

        随后,打开IDE,进入IDE的配置界面。

        在下述位置选择合适的路径后,点击 "Next"。

        勾选 "Accept",随后点击 "Next"。 

        等待下载完成...

        点击Finish完成安装。

        至此,所有相关配置已经完成。

四、创建新工程

4.1 工程创建

        点击左侧菜单栏 "Create Project" 。

        选择 " Empty Project " ,然后点击 " Next "。

        自定义工程名称和路径,随后点击 "Finish"。 

        等待至工程初始化完成即可。

4.2 程序完善

        在pages/index.ets文件中,完善我们的代码,显示Hello OpenHarmony。

        4.2.1 程序代码

@Entry  
@Component  
struct Index {  
  build() {  
    Flex({ direction: FlexDirection.Column, alignItems: ItemAlign.Center, justifyContent: FlexAlign.Center }) {  
      Text('Hello OpenHarmony!')  
        .fontSize(50)  
        .fontWeight(FontWeight.Bold)  
      Button('Click Me')  
        .onClick(() => {  
          console.log('Button clicked!');  
        })  
    }  
    .width('100%')  
    .height('100%')  
  }  
}

五、总结

        本文中我们顺利创建了OpenHarmony工程,开发中DevEco Studio还提供了丰富的调试功能,包括断点调试、日志查看等。我们可以根据调试结果,对代码进行优化,提升应用性能和用户体验,写出更好的OpenHarmony程序。

        让我们为鸿蒙生态献出力量,助力鸿蒙生态。

Logo

社区规范:仅讨论OpenHarmony相关问题。

更多推荐